Art Quote by Amy Hardie
“I think both science and art are impelled by curiosity: What's really happening? How do things really function? How can I really engage with the world around me? These are questions that artists and scientists both ask.”
About This Quote
Source Lecture: Interdisciplinary Creativity, 2021
She argues that both science and art stem from curiosity about how the world works and how to engage with it.
In simple terms: Science and art share curiosity.
